Quick note on the Fernhollow prototype workshop: facilities folks can pop in anytime for maintenance, but give the Makerden team a heads-up if machines are running. Safety glasses live by the door — wear them, no exceptions. Lights and extraction fans off when you leave. The roller door sticks, so use the side entrance, keyed with the code below.

staff pass of kawip-hawef = bdg-QLP-2

**Action item: REST pagination fixes (Lattermill API)**

Cursor pagination replaced offset pagination after the timeout incident. Plugin authors: offset params are now ignored; use the cursor token from each response. Requests without a page size get the default; oversized requests are clamped, not rejected. Update clients before the deprecation date in the changelog. Current limits are set out below.

tuning constants:
QUOTAS = {
    "druwyn": 5,
    "holix": 5,
    "zorath": 5,
    "holwyn": 10,
}

Welcome to the Ledgerline payments team. Every retryable charge request must carry an idempotency key so duplicate submissions don't double-bill merchants. Our gateway, Tollgate, stores keys for 48 hours and returns the original response on replay. Generate keys client-side per logical payment attempt, not per HTTP call, and reuse them across retries. Tollgate rejects mismatched payloads under the same key with a 409. To exercise this against the staging gateway, authenticate using the key below.

gateway credential: kto23_LX9A4ys6i4nzHtpOLNLodKK